A vehicular seat belt device (10; 60) includes a first pretensioner (22) provided in a retractor (21) and configured to apply tensile force to a shoulder belt portion (20A) of a webbing (20), a second pretensioner (24) provided in a belt anchor part (23) and configured to apply tensile force to a lap belt portion (20B) of the webbing (20), a third pretensioner (30) provided in a side portion of the vehicle seat (12) opposite to the belt anchor part (23) and configured to apply tensile force to the lap belt portion (20B) via a buckle (26), and a controller (48). The controller (48) is configured to activate the first pretensioner (22) at a time of predicting vehicle collision, and activate the second pretensioner (24) and the third pretensioner (30) after detection of collision.
